Laxman Prasad Acharya became the Governor of Assam, Gulab Chand Kataria was sent to Punjab, Governors of many states were changed

Laxman Prasad Acharya has been appointed as the new Governor of Assam with additional charge of Manipur. Gulab Chand Kataria has been appointed as the Governor of Punjab in place of Banwarilal Purohit. Rashtrapati Bhavan has announced this. According to a press release issued by Rashtrapati Bhavan on Saturday night, Laxman Prasad Acharya has replaced Gulab Chand Kataria, who has also been appointed as the Administrator of the Union Territory of Chandigarh.

It said that President Draupadi Murmu has accepted the resignation of Banwarilal Purohit from the post of Governor of Punjab and Administrator of Chandigarh. The statement said, ‘Sikkim Governor Laxman Prasad Acharya has been appointed Governor of Assam and has also been given additional charge of Governor of Manipur.’

Governors of many states changed

Anusuiya Uikey has been serving as the Governor of Manipur since February last year. Senior BJP leader Om Prakash Mathur will be the new Governor of Sikkim. Jharkhand Governor C P Radhakrishnan, who was also holding additional charge of Telangana, has been appointed as the new Governor of Maharashtra in place of incumbent Ramesh Bais.

Santosh Kumar Gangwar will be the governor of Jharkhand

Former Union Labour and Employment Minister Santosh Kumar Gangwar will replace Radhakrishnan as the new Governor of Jharkhand. Former Tripura Deputy Chief Minister Jishnu Dev Varma will be the new Governor of Telangana. Former IAS officer K Kailashnathan, one of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s trusted aides, has been appointed as the Lieutenant Governor of Puducherry.

Haribhau Kisanrao Bagde will be the new governor of Rajasthan

Senior BJP leader from Maharashtra Haribhau Kisanrao Bagde has been appointed Governor of Rajasthan in place of Kalraj Mishra. The release said that former Lok Sabha member from Assam Ramen Deka has been appointed Governor of Chhattisgarh. Former Lok Sabha member from Mysore, Karnataka CH Vijayshankar will be the Governor of Meghalaya.
